Which one of the following ions has electronic configuration[Ar] 3d⁶? (At. no: Mn=25, Fe=26, Co=27, Ni=28)
Options
(a) Ni³⁺
(b) Mn³⁺
(c) Fe³⁺
(d) Co³⁺
Correct Answer:
Co³⁺
Explanation:
Ni³⁺ (28) = [Ar] 3d⁷
Mn³⁺ (25) = [Ar] 3d⁴
Fe³⁺ (26) = [Ar] 3d⁵
Co³⁺ (27) = [Ar] 3d⁶
